Types of Pedal Crank Bearings

There are two main types of pedal crank bearings:

pedal crank bearings

  1. Cartridge Bearings: These bearings are sealed units that house the balls or rollers within a cylindrical casing. They require minimal maintenance and offer excellent durability.
  2. Loose Ball Bearings: These bearings consist of individual balls or rollers that are inserted directly into the crank and axle. They provide a more customizable feel but require regular lubrication and cleaning.

Materials Used in Pedal Crank Bearings

The balls or rollers in pedal crank bearings are typically made from one of the following materials:

  1. Steel: A common choice due to its durability, strength, and affordability.
  2. Ceramic: More expensive but offers better corrosion resistance and rolling efficiency.
  3. Nylon: Provides a quieter ride and is self-lubricating.

Pedal Crank Bearing Maintenance Tips

To extend the lifespan of your pedal crank bearings, follow these maintenance tips:

  1. Lubricate regularly: The type of lubrication required will vary depending on the bearing type. Consult your bicycle manufacturer's manual for specific recommendations.
  2. Clean regularly: Use a soft brush or cloth to remove dirt and debris from the bearings and surrounding area.
  3. Avoid overtightening: Overtightening the crank bolts can put excessive pressure on the bearings, leading to premature failure.
  4. Replace worn bearings promptly: Ignoring worn bearings can lead to further damage to the crankset and axle.
